- The cancellation policy can vary by ticket class, individual trips, or promotions, so it's best to check the terms during booking.
- FlixBus
- You can cancel your ticket up to 15 minutes before departure and receive a voucher for future travel. Refund requests for delays over 120 minutes are possible.
- Itabus
- You can cancel your ticket up to 24 hours before departure for a partial refund. Changes allowed for a fee.
- Autoservizi Salemi
- Two pieces of luggage: one large suitcase for the hold and one smaller backpack for on-board.
- FlixBus
- One carry-on bag up to 7kg (42x30x18 cm) and one checked bag up to 20kg (80x50x30 cm).
- Itabus
- One carry-on bag up to 10kg and one checked bag up to 20kg.
- Infobus
- 10€ per additional bag.
- FlixBus
- Additional luggage can be purchased for a fee.
- Itabus
- 5€ per additional bag.

Most Palermo to Milan buses use the Palermo, Via Tommaso Fazello (Terminal Bus) to Milano, Autostazione Lampugnano station pair, with some services arriving at Milano, San Donato - Settore B (Viale Giuseppe Impastato).
